In the field of Integrated Circuit (IC) design, digital layout can often be automated using Electronic Design Automation (EDA) tools. However, analog layout remains a highly specialized hand-craft. For decades, engineers and students have turned to Alan Hastings’ seminal textbook, The Art of Analog Layout , as the definitive blueprint for mastering this discipline.

Analog circuits, such as differential pairs and current mirrors, require components (transistors, resistors, capacitors) to behave identically. However, manufacturing variations occur across a wafer.
A significant portion of the book is dedicated to reliability. Hastings details how to design robust Input/Output (I/O) cells that can withstand thousands of volts of static electricity without destroying the internal circuitry. Electrostatic Discharge (ESD) structures are often an afterthought. Hastings dedicates serious ink to explaining why output transistors need ballasting and how to layout a silicon-controlled rectifier (SCR) for maximum protection.
